Abstract

A 10-port wideband multi input antenna array suitable with 4G/5G mobile phones applications is presented. Ten C-shaped slot antenna components are embedded on the FR4 substrate to form the multiple input multiple output (MIMO) system. All antenna elements in the MIMO system operates between 2.3 and 4.5 GHz with an impedance bandwidth of −10 dB (2:1 VSWR ratio). Nonetheless, the MIMO antenna can operate between 2.2 and 5 GHz with a −6 dB impedance bandwidth (includes LTE bands 38,40,41,42,43,48,49 and 52) which is about 77.7% fractional bandwidth of the center frequency (3.6 GHz). By combining spatial and polarisation diversity approaches, substantial isolation (>20 dB) between any pair of antennas is achieved. The designed 10-port MIMO antenna array has been constructed and tested, and the measured findings agree with the simulation results. The radiation efficiency of the antenna is around 79%–83% over the frequency spectrum of operation. Additionally, MIMO metrics include the envelope correlation coefficient, channel capacity and total active reflection coefficient are determined. The antenna's reliability is determined by the hand phantom effects and specific absorption rate.
